Harold Henry Westerman & Ethel Mae (Helmke) Westerman
Harold Henry Westerman was born February 8, 1924, at Nashville, Kansas, son
of Henry and Edna (Hensiek) Westerman. He was baptized February 24, 1924, in
St. John's Lutheran Church, Nashville, by Pasotr F.C. Duecker and confirmed
by Pastor P.G. Krause. He has always lived in the Nashville/Zenda communities.
Ethel Mae Westerman was born April 15, 1926, at Pratt, Kansas, eighth child
of Friederich and Blanche (Dellinger) Helmke. She was baptized at Natrona,
Kansas, by the Rev. Hilst and confirmed at St. John's Lutheran Church,
Nashville, Kansas, by the Rev. Mueller. She moved from Pratt to Zenda when
she was eleven years old.
Harold and Ethel were married May 14, 1950, at Nashville, Kansas, by Pastor
Herman C. Seyfert. They had four children. Mark was born NOvember 6, 1952;
Beth Ann, March 16, 1957; Emery Andrew, January 6, 1960; and Orrin Joey,
February 4, 1962. Mark is married to Joyce Bernhardt and has one daughter,
Brittany. Beth is married to Norbert Blasi and has two daughters, Erin and
Audra. Emery is married to Jennifer McGuire and has a son, Andrew, and
daughter, Emily. Orrin has so far remained a bachelor and is farming.
Ethel typed church bulletins for nine years, belonged to Dorcas Society,
sang in choir and taught Sunday School. Harold was on the parish school
board for eighteen years, served as elder six years and served on LLL Zone
Board for five years. He has been president of Men's Club for twenty years.
Ethel and Harld are still living on the place where they started their
married life forty-two years ago. He is a retired farmer and she does income
tax.
Source:St. John's Lutheran Church Centennial 1893-1993, Nashville, Kansas, pg. 99
